Press Release: "Experts Unveil First 'Blueprint for Action'
for Childhood Asthma"
Childhood asthma is an epidemic with major public health and
financial consequences. In hopes of stemming this growing
problem, the Rand Corporation, as part of Robert Wood Johnson's
Pediatric Asthma Initiative, convened a panel of 10 nationally
recognized experts and leaders in childhood asthma from across

Improving
Childhood Asthma Outcomes in the United States: A Blueprint
for Policy Action
Effective primary care can help children with asthma lead
fully functional lives and prevent costly hospitalization,
yet the human and financial costs of childhood asthma continue
to grow. This report, available through RAND, describes a
set of policy recommendations to promote the development and
maintenance of communities in which children with asthma can
be diagnosed and effectively treated and protected from exposure
to harmful environmental factors.
